Susan Boyle to make film debut with The Christmas Candle

John Stephenson

MUMBAI: Scottish singer Susan Boyle will make her debut in a film titled The Christmas Candle, said to be a British holiday period film.The 51-year-old Boyle will join Samantha Barks, Hans Matheson and Lesley Manville in the film that began production this week on location in the United Kingdom and the Isle of Man.

Based on the novella by Max Lucado, the film tells the tale of an enchanted Christmas candle in Gladbury, a dull village that must confront the dawning of the 20th century and a new skeptical minister.

There was however no information as to what role the songstress will play."Everyone on set is a delight to work with and it‘s a fantastic experience to be part of the team," the lady said in a statement.

The singer became an overnight international sensation in 2009 after appearing on variety show Britain‘s Got Talent and performing a flawless rendition of I Dreamed a Dream from the musical Les Miserables.

The Christmas Candle, produced by Impact and Big Book Media, will be directed by John Stephenson.
